Skip to content

Instantly share code, notes, and snippets.

@lin1000
Last active December 15, 2018 17:31
Show Gist options
  • Save lin1000/26cfe02ff84943c0de6bf73c4025266c to your computer and use it in GitHub Desktop.
Save lin1000/26cfe02ff84943c0de6bf73c4025266c to your computer and use it in GitHub Desktop.
Visual Studio Code Settings Sync Gist
{"lastUpload":"2018-12-15T17:31:24.279Z","extensionVersion":"v3.2.3"}
[
{
"metadata": {
"id": "c821cdcd-134b-4c94-99ab-34d3cd83ab74",
"publisherId": "haaaad.ansible",
"publisherDisplayName": "haaaad"
},
"name": "ansible",
"publisher": "haaaad",
"version": "0.2.8"
},
{
"metadata": {
"id": "819a23e1-b6c6-41cf-9029-e653b537d996",
"publisherId": "ms-vscode.azure-account",
"publisherDisplayName": "ms-vscode"
},
"name": "azure-account",
"publisher": "ms-vscode",
"version": "0.6.2"
},
{
"metadata": {
"id": "e337c67b-55c2-4fef-8949-eb260e7fb7fd",
"publisherId": "Shan.code-settings-sync",
"publisherDisplayName": "Shan"
},
"name": "code-settings-sync",
"publisher": "Shan",
"version": "3.2.3"
},
{
"metadata": {
"id": "690b692e-e8a9-493f-b802-8089d50ac1b2",
"publisherId": "ms-vscode.cpptools",
"publisherDisplayName": "ms-vscode"
},
"name": "cpptools",
"publisher": "ms-vscode",
"version": "0.20.1"
},
{
"metadata": {
"id": "1609fafb-007d-4ae3-a43c-af7b15a62676",
"publisherId": "MarioSchwalbe.gnuplot",
"publisherDisplayName": "MarioSchwalbe"
},
"name": "gnuplot",
"publisher": "MarioSchwalbe",
"version": "1.0.11"
},
{
"metadata": {
"id": "198a707e-28af-4e84-8610-6e2f628dd12d",
"publisherId": "redhat.java",
"publisherDisplayName": "redhat"
},
"name": "java",
"publisher": "redhat",
"version": "0.35.0"
},
{
"metadata": {
"id": "c941a679-d500-46a8-b2a9-208063125901",
"publisherId": "wholroyd.jinja",
"publisherDisplayName": "wholroyd"
},
"name": "jinja",
"publisher": "wholroyd",
"version": "0.0.8"
},
{
"metadata": {
"id": "8b477a76-974c-403d-a454-58028c1709d1",
"publisherId": "samuelcolvin.jinjahtml",
"publisherDisplayName": "samuelcolvin"
},
"name": "jinjahtml",
"publisher": "samuelcolvin",
"version": "0.4.0"
},
{
"metadata": {
"id": "de056427-d058-4b9c-8408-54d6bfe742bf",
"publisherId": "tberman.json-schema-validator",
"publisherDisplayName": "tberman"
},
"name": "json-schema-validator",
"publisher": "tberman",
"version": "0.1.0"
},
{
"metadata": {
"id": "1bf2afc4-296d-482b-89ff-3318c474a2a8",
"publisherId": "ipedrazas.kubernetes-snippets",
"publisherDisplayName": "ipedrazas"
},
"name": "kubernetes-snippets",
"publisher": "ipedrazas",
"version": "0.1.9"
},
{
"metadata": {
"id": "dff6b801-247e-40e9-82e8-8c9b1d19d1b8",
"publisherId": "christian-kohler.npm-intellisense",
"publisherDisplayName": "christian-kohler"
},
"name": "npm-intellisense",
"publisher": "christian-kohler",
"version": "1.3.0"
},
{
"metadata": {
"id": "97066004-5dfd-40e6-a901-073761213cbd",
"publisherId": "adammaras.overtype",
"publisherDisplayName": "adammaras"
},
"name": "overtype",
"publisher": "adammaras",
"version": "0.2.0"
},
{
"metadata": {
"id": "ea52326c-68a8-4587-a2f0-abb0a91e455a",
"publisherId": "xyz.plsql-language",
"publisherDisplayName": "xyz"
},
"name": "plsql-language",
"publisher": "xyz",
"version": "1.6.5"
},
{
"metadata": {
"id": "67e66172-30c7-4478-8f5d-6eac4ae755dc",
"publisherId": "mohsen1.prettify-json",
"publisherDisplayName": "mohsen1"
},
"name": "prettify-json",
"publisher": "mohsen1",
"version": "0.0.3"
},
{
"metadata": {
"id": "77faa0fb-6627-46fd-91b4-efee10f6397d",
"publisherId": "vthiery.prettify-selected-json",
"publisherDisplayName": "vthiery"
},
"name": "prettify-selected-json",
"publisher": "vthiery",
"version": "1.0.3"
},
{
"metadata": {
"id": "6a044663-ad82-4bb1-ac51-301c82e6f213",
"publisherId": "dmitry-korobchenko.prototxt",
"publisherDisplayName": "dmitry-korobchenko"
},
"name": "prototxt",
"publisher": "dmitry-korobchenko",
"version": "0.0.6"
},
{
"metadata": {
"id": "f1f59ae4-9318-4f3c-a9b5-81b2eaa5f8a5",
"publisherId": "ms-python.python",
"publisherDisplayName": "ms-python"
},
"name": "python",
"publisher": "ms-python",
"version": "2018.11.0"
},
{
"metadata": {
"id": "b4e4671b-cc3c-4078-8496-571ef1099fc7",
"publisherId": "ferdinandsilva.vsc-figlet",
"publisherDisplayName": "ferdinandsilva"
},
"name": "vsc-figlet",
"publisher": "ferdinandsilva",
"version": "0.0.8"
},
{
"metadata": {
"id": "2b05803e-d7e9-433f-bce9-255e4d4ad79e",
"publisherId": "vscoss.vscode-ansible",
"publisherDisplayName": "vscoss"
},
"name": "vscode-ansible",
"publisher": "vscoss",
"version": "0.5.2"
},
{
"metadata": {
"id": "0479fc1c-3d67-49f9-b087-fb9069afe48f",
"publisherId": "PeterJausovec.vscode-docker",
"publisherDisplayName": "PeterJausovec"
},
"name": "vscode-docker",
"publisher": "PeterJausovec",
"version": "0.4.0"
},
{
"metadata": {
"id": "583b2b34-2c1e-4634-8c0b-0b82e283ea3a",
"publisherId": "dbaeumer.vscode-eslint",
"publisherDisplayName": "dbaeumer"
},
"name": "vscode-eslint",
"publisher": "dbaeumer",
"version": "1.7.0"
},
{
"metadata": {
"id": "95dcafc3-2012-45bf-aac1-0b5345e0daf1",
"publisherId": "slevesque.vscode-hexdump",
"publisherDisplayName": "slevesque"
},
"name": "vscode-hexdump",
"publisher": "slevesque",
"version": "1.7.2"
},
{
"metadata": {
"id": "b7495032-d1d3-4be2-a2a1-695559fcd3d6",
"publisherId": "dbankier.vscode-instant-markdown",
"publisherDisplayName": "dbankier"
},
"name": "vscode-instant-markdown",
"publisher": "dbankier",
"version": "1.4.3"
},
{
"metadata": {
"id": "61fcd0cf-64d7-4836-8d6b-d55f4fb83281",
"publisherId": "vscjava.vscode-java-debug",
"publisherDisplayName": "vscjava"
},
"name": "vscode-java-debug",
"publisher": "vscjava",
"version": "0.15.0"
},
{
"metadata": {
"id": "8bd907de-999c-4f06-9be1-f74a06da52fb",
"publisherId": "georgewfraser.vscode-javac",
"publisherDisplayName": "georgewfraser"
},
"name": "vscode-javac",
"publisher": "georgewfraser",
"version": "0.2.6"
},
{
"metadata": {
"id": "4837e4f3-1b01-4732-b1a6-daa57ef64cab",
"publisherId": "ms-kubernetes-tools.vscode-kubernetes-tools",
"publisherDisplayName": "ms-kubernetes-tools"
},
"name": "vscode-kubernetes-tools",
"publisher": "ms-kubernetes-tools",
"version": "0.1.14"
},
{
"metadata": {
"id": "daf8b44d-8aae-4da2-80c5-1f770219f643",
"publisherId": "DavidAnson.vscode-markdownlint",
"publisherDisplayName": "DavidAnson"
},
"name": "vscode-markdownlint",
"publisher": "DavidAnson",
"version": "0.22.0"
},
{
"metadata": {
"id": "b0f06c6b-24fb-4d7b-bd79-bc5e2fa17312",
"publisherId": "vscjava.vscode-maven",
"publisherDisplayName": "vscjava"
},
"name": "vscode-maven",
"publisher": "vscjava",
"version": "0.11.3"
},
{
"metadata": {
"id": "2061917f-f76a-458a-8da9-f162de22b97e",
"publisherId": "redhat.vscode-yaml",
"publisherDisplayName": "redhat"
},
"name": "vscode-yaml",
"publisher": "redhat",
"version": "0.1.0"
}
]
// Place your key bindings in this file to overwrite the defaults
[
{
"key": "enter",
"command": "-acceptSelectedSuggestionOnEnter",
"when": "acceptSuggestionOnEnter && editorTextFocus && suggestWidgetVisible && suggestionMakesTextEdit"
}
]
// Place your settings in this file to overwrite the default settings
{
"editor.lineNumbers": "on",
"java.home": "/Library/Java/JavaVirtualMachines/jdk1.8.0_131.jdk/Contents/Home",
"terminal.integrated.fontSize": 10,
"terminal.integrated.scrollback": 50000,
"editor.detectIndentation": true,
"editor.insertSpaces": true,
"python.linting.enabledWithoutWorkspace": false,
"python.linting.lintOnSave": false,
"typescript.check.npmIsInstalled": false,
"editor.multiCursorModifier": "ctrlCmd",
"workbench.colorTheme": "Quiet Light",
"window.zoomLevel": -1,
// Controls if quick suggestions should show up while typing
"editor.quickSuggestions": true,
// Enable parameter hints
"editor.parameterHints": false,
// Controls the delay in ms after which quick suggestions will show up
"editor.quickSuggestionsDelay": 2,
"C_Cpp.intelliSenseEngine": "Tag Parser",
//instant markdown
"instantmarkdown.autoOpenBrowser" : false,
//change friendly font for devloper,
"editor.fontFamily": "Hack",
"sync.gist": "26cfe02ff84943c0de6bf73c4025266c",
"sync.lastUpload": "2017-10-09T04:28:55.362Z",
"sync.autoDownload": false,
"sync.autoUpload": false,
"sync.lastDownload": "",
"sync.forceDownload": false,
"sync.anonymousGist": false,
"sync.host": "",
"sync.pathPrefix": "",
"sync.quietSync": false,
"sync.askGistName": false,
"extensions.ignoreRecommendations": false,
"java.errors.incompleteClasspath.severity": "ignore",
"explorer.confirmDelete": false,
//javaclasspath
"java.classPath": [
"~/.m2/repository/"
],
"[java]": {
},
"files.exclude": {
"**/.svn": false
},
"explorer.openEditors.visible": 4,
"editor.fontSize": 11
}
{
/*
// Place your snippets for Java here. Each snippet is defined under a snippet name and has a prefix, body and
// description. The prefix is what is used to trigger the snippet and the body will be expanded and inserted. Possible variables are:
// $1, $2 for tab stops, $0 for the final cursor position, and ${1:label}, ${2:another} for placeholders. Placeholders with the
// same ids are connected.
// Example:
"Print to console": {
"prefix": "log",
"body": [
"console.log('$1');",
"$2"
],
"description": "Log output to console"
}
*/
"Getter/Setter": {
"prefix": "getset",
"body": [
"public ${1:int} get${2:Attribute}() {",
"\treturn this.${3:attribute};",
"}",
"public void set${2:Attribute}(${1:int} ${3:attribute}) {",
"\tthis.${3:attribute} = ${3:attribute};",
"}"
],
"description": "Generate getter/setter for class attributes"
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ment